alanyuchenhou / athanasea

Advanced virtual animal rescue web app (CAUTION: site under construction)
https://athanasea.herokuapp.com
MIT License
3 stars 3 forks source link

Getting more done in GitHub with ZenHub #9

Closed alanyuchenhou closed 8 years ago

alanyuchenhou commented 8 years ago

Hola! @yuchenhou has created a ZenHub account for the yuchenhou organization. ZenHub is the leading team collaboration and project management solution built for GitHub.


How do I use ZenHub?

To get set up with ZenHub, all you have to do is download the browser extension and log in with your GitHub account. Once you do, you’ll get access to ZenHub’s complete feature-set immediately.

What can ZenHub do?

ZenHub adds a series of enhancements directly inside the GitHub UI:

_Still curious? See more ZenHub features or read user reviews. This issue was written by your friendly ZenHub bot, posted by request from @yuchenhou._

ZenHub Board

alanyuchenhou commented 8 years ago

@ylhou We are asked to log our work hours, let's use Zenhub as our project manager.

alanyuchenhou commented 8 years ago

Let's assume 1 story point = 1 hour.

alanyuchenhou commented 8 years ago

@ylhou @Taxidea-Jen , In order to improve the transparency of the project's progress, and a smooth communication and collaboration, we can use the task boards and burndown chart to keep track of issues(tasks) as they go through the pipeline: every task starts in "backlog"; the task flows into "to do" when it's scheduled for current milestone(with milestone, estimate specified); then it flows in "in progress" when someone starts to work on it(with assignee specified); then it flows in "done" when the assignee considers it done; then it flows in "closed" when a reviewer considers it "really done". Ideally, the assignee and the reviewer should be volunteered, but different persons. Any thoughts?

Taxidea-Jen commented 8 years ago

Most of that was gibberish to me, so if that's what you think is best, then go for it.

alanyuchenhou commented 8 years ago

@Taxidea-Jen sorry about the confusion: for you, it just means you can view our progress at the task board.

Taxidea-Jen commented 8 years ago

Not a problem. The link you made doesn't go anywhere, but I'm sure I can find the task board if you point me in the right direction.

alanyuchenhou commented 8 years ago

Sure. Can you see these 2 screenshots I attached? board burndown

Taxidea-Jen commented 8 years ago

Yes. Do I need to find ZipHub in order to view those pages?

Taxidea-Jen commented 8 years ago

ZenHub, that's what I meant.

Taxidea-Jen commented 8 years ago

One hiccup is that I don't use Google Chrome. I use Safari or Firefox for my web browser.

alanyuchenhou commented 8 years ago

It should work with firefox. Can you give it a try?